Output 85843c5b42a1b46a206aed7f81a364128fd2b1d3c20b4a9cd051aec267636999:3

value
11875
script pubkey
OP_0 OP_PUSHBYTES_20 b6ed68ecaf45686559c88b755832074dc73e0b12
address
bc1qkmkk3m90g45x2kwg3d64svs8fhrnuzcjafxmja
transaction
85843c5b42a1b46a206aed7f81a364128fd2b1d3c20b4a9cd051aec267636999
confirmations
76509
spent
true